Promenade sur la plage by H. Claude Pissarro
Hugues Claude Pissarro
b.1935 | French
Promenade sur la plage
(Walk on the Beach)
Signed âH. Claude Pissarroâ (lower right)
Oil on canvas
A sunlit beach path meanders through a vibrant coastal scene in Promenade sur la plage by French artist H. Claude Pissarro. A majestic palm tree anchors the foreground, its vivid green fronds contrasting beautifully with the masterful interplay of purples and blues in the shadows, illustrating the artistâs signature impasto technique and vibrant palette. Beneath its canopy, a couple strolls together, savoring the serenity of the moment alongside fellow pedestrians. Nearby, a bicycle rests, contributing to the quiet bustle of beachside life. In the distance, shoreline buildings extend along the horizon, leading the viewer deeper into this picturesque seaside town. Pissarroâs exquisite rendering of light, color and texture imbues the scene with warmth and vitality, perfectly encapsulating the elegance and timeless charm of his oeuvre.
Hailing from a long lineage of artists, including Impressionist Camille Pissarro, Pissarro's artistic talents were cultivated at an early age. He exhibited his first works at the young age of 14 and later studied in Paris at the Ăcole du Louvre and Ăcole Normale SupĂ©rieure. A 1959 White House commission to paint the portrait of President Eisenhower cemented his reputation as an artist of renown, and his work has since been featured in important exhibitions throughout Europe and the United States. While his style has evolved throughout his career, he is best known for his energetic pastel compositions. H. Claude Pissarroâs works have been exhibited and collected throughout the world, and they remain highly coveted for their intimate size and relatable subject matter.
